Closed Bug 263430 Opened 20 years ago Closed 20 years ago

XTF enabled build failure with GCC 3.4.2

Categories

(SeaMonkey :: General, defect)

x86
Linux
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: peter.kovar, Unassigned)

Details

Attachments

(1 file)

User-Agent:       Mozilla/5.0 (X11; U; Linux i686; sk-SK; rv:1.8a5) Gecko/20041005
Build Identifier: Mozilla/5.0 (X11; U; Linux i686; sk-SK; rv:1.8a5) Gecko/20041005

GCC 3.4.2 is bit more strict. Extra ; at the end of NS_IMPL_ISUPPORTS1 macros
are not ignored like with GCC 3.3.3 or older compilers.


Reproducible: Always
Steps to Reproduce:
1. configure with --enable-xtf
2. GCC 3.4.2

Actual Results:  
nsXMLContentBuilder.cpp:120: error: extra `;'
Attached patch Fix XTF buildSplinter Review
Remove extra ;
Thanks for the patch!
Fix checked in.
Status: UNCONFIRMED → RESOLVED
Closed: 20 years ago
Resolution: --- → FIXED
Product: Browser → Seamonkey
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: